The International Environmental 71533712 Capacitor is a high-performance 15 MFD 370V oval run capacitor designed for demanding HVACR applications, specifically within IEC fan coil units and blower systems. Engineered to optimize motor run efficiency, this single-value capacitor assists with the phase shift required for PSC (Permanent Split Capacitor) motors to operate with appropriate torque and reduced heat buildup. The oval run capacitor configuration ensures a compact footprint, allowing for seamless integration into tight electrical control boxes where space is at a premium.

Built with metallized polypropylene film technology and encapsulated in a rugged aluminum case, this component is designed to withstand a 370 VAC operating environment while maintaining a stable 15 microfarad capacitance rating. It features quad-blade quick-connect terminals (1/4") for fast, secure field wiring and a pressure-sensitive interrupter for circuit safety. This OEM replacement part meets UL 810 standards, ensuring reliable performance in both residential and commercial climate control equipment.

Common Questions:

Can I use a 440V rated capacitor to replace this 370V unit?
Yes. In HVACR service, you can always use a higher voltage rating (e.g., 440V) to replace a lower one (370V), provided the capacitance (15 MFD) and physical shape match. You must never go lower than the original voltage rating.

What are the signs that this run capacitor has failed?
Common indicators include a visible bulge or swelling of the aluminum casing, leaking dielectric fluid, or a blower motor that hums but fails to start. Testing with a multimeter should show a reading within +/- 6% of 15 MFD.

Does it matter which wire goes to which terminal on a single run capacitor?
Since this is a single-value non-polarized capacitor, there is no designated "positive" or "negative." However, it is standard practice to maintain the original wiring configuration using the silver quick-connect posts.
